Activities & Experiences Around Michigan

In addition to the diverse accommodation options, Michigan offers a wealth of activities that can enhance any corporate event. Attendees can explore the cultural richness of cities like Detroit through museums and art galleries, or experience outdoor adventures in places like the Pictured Rocks National Lakeshore. For those interested in local flavors, Michigan's wine trails and farm-to-table dining experiences provide excellent options for networking and socializing outside of formal meeting times. History enthusiasts will enjoy visiting landmarks and architectural wonders, such as the Henry Ford Museum and the charming town of Holland.

After hours, executives can unwind at vibrant nightlife spots, enjoy live music in multiple venues, or take part in seasonal festivals that showcase Michigan's unique culture. Sports fans may also appreciate the chance to catch a game from Detroit's professional teams or participate in local recreational sports events.

How Much Does a Hotel Event in Michigan Cost?

The cost of hosting a hotel event in Michigan varies based on several factors, including the venue type, location, time of year, and amenities included. Typically, pricing for meeting spaces starts around $500 for small rooms, while larger venues can range from $3,000 to $10,000 per day. Accommodations and catering expenses may add to the total cost, but many hotels offer packages that include various services at competitive rates. It's essential to consult with venues directly for accurate quotes and the best deals.

Accessibility & Transport in Michigan

Reaching Michigan is convenient, thanks to major airports like Detroit Metropolitan Airport and Gerald R. Ford International Airport providing extensive flight options. Michigan is also accessible via several interstate highways, making it easy to reach by car. Amtrak trains travel to various Michigan cities, offering another alternative for travelers. Once you're in the state, local transportation options including ride-shares and public transit make navigating between hotels and event venues straightforward.
